The transcript discusses ongoing intensive discussions in London regarding Brexit, leading to a special Council meeting where Prime Minister Theresa May will present a proposal. The EU aims to maintain unity among its 27 members and is committed to preventing a no deal Brexit, emphasizing the need for collaboration with Britain.
